If Lewis-Palmer was riding high off their 15-5 takedown of Palmer Ridge last Tuesday, their most recent game may have dampened their spirits a bit. The Lewis-Palmer Rangers fell just short of the Palmer Ridge Bears by a score of 8-7 on Thursday. Lewis-Palmer was given a dose of their own medicine in this game as Palmer Ridge apparently hadn't forgotten their loss the last time these teams played.
Alvin Jarrell put in work while hitting and pitching. He struck out nine batters over 4.2 innings while giving up just two earned (and one unearned) runs off six hits. Jarrell has been nothing but reliable on the mound: he hasn't tossed less than five strikeouts in three consecutive pitching appearances. Jarrell was also big at the plate, going 1-for-1 with a triple.
In other batting news, Danny Cook was cooking despite his team's loss, scoring two runs and stealing three bases while going 1-for-3. He has been hot recently, having posted at least one stolen base the last three times he's played. Another player making a difference was John Raine, who went 1-for-4 with a triple and two RBI.
Even though they lost, Lewis-Palmer didn't let batters stay on the plate for long and finished the game with 11 strikeouts. They easily outclassed their opponents in that department as Palmer Ridge only tossed six.
On Palmer Ridge's side, the team relied heavily on Cooper Havenar, who went 2-for-4 with three RBI, two runs, and a triple. Sergio Melendez was another key contributor, scoring two runs and stealing two bases while going 1-for-4.
Lewis-Palmer's defeat dropped their record down to 9-5. As for Palmer Ridge, their win bumped their record up to 6-9.
Lewis-Palmer will be playing at home against Vista Ridge at 4:00 p.m. on Monday. Lewis-Palmer is strutting in with some hitting muscle, as they've averaged 8.9 runs per game this season. As for Palmer Ridge, they will be playing at home against Lutheran at 4:00 p.m. on Tuesday. Lutheran is coming into the contest with five straight victories on the road, so Palmer Ridge will have to stop a team with plenty of momentum.
